Cyber cafe logo design tips
A memorable cyber cafe logo wins walk-ins because it signals the gaming culture inside before a customer reaches the door. Apply these four principles when customizing your cyber cafe logo template.
Design for storefront signage and station decals
Your logo will live on a backlit storefront sign that customers see from across the street and on a 40mm decal stuck to a gaming rig. Test it at both sizes. If the mark loses detail on the decal or melts into glow on the sign, simplify the shapes and tighten the contrast before locking the design.
Pick a palette that reads in RGB-lit rooms
Deep black, electric purple, neon cyan, and signal red form the most-used cyber cafe palette because they read clearly under RGB ambient lighting and on dark monitor backgrounds. Pair one dominant neon with black or charcoal. Avoid pale pastels: they vanish in the low-light, high-saturation interior gamers expect.
Choose typography with a gaming or tech feel
Pixel, geometric sans-serif, and sharp angular type read as gaming and tech. Italic and slanted faces add motion that fits an esports lounge. Avoid soft handwritten scripts and warm coffee-shop serifs: they undercut the competitive energy a cyber cafe needs to project at the door.
Use a symbol tied to your gaming format
Generic gamepads and arcade joysticks are crowded across the cyber cafe category. Differentiate with a symbol tied to your format: a stylized headset for an esports lounge, a power button or pixel mark for a PC bang, a console outline for a console gaming bar, a LAN-cable knot for a LAN-party hub, or an abstract chevron for a multi-format gaming venue.

Cyber cafe logo styles that work
Sharp geometric marks with pixel or condensed sans-serif type fit esports lounges and PC bangs because they signal competitive intensity at the door. Cleaner rounded sans-serifs and warmer accents suit casual internet cafes where work, study, and gaming all happen in the same room. Aggressive italic and slab type works for LAN-party hubs and tournament venues where the event is the differentiator. Pick a cyber cafe logo style that matches the gaming culture your venue is built around.
